Hi, just returned from a honeymoon at Turtle Bay Hotel. The area surrounding the hotel is beautiful and quite peaceful. The hotel facilities are great although the pool area can be quite crowded as it is only small. Noise from the kids can be a pain as they are close too. The bay you will be sharing is well kept and a nice beach bar for all is open till late. Although you cant sit at a table unless you eat there. There is still a bar stool if you need one.
The wind is moderate to refreshing in May and the reef protects most of the bay from the waves. You can feel the waves when snorkelling and the visabilty is poor. Plenty of fish life tho so its kinda worth it.
Better views underwater can be obtained from Sharks Cove or 3 Tables on the road west.
Other than that i think you will have a great time. If peace and quiet is what your looking for.
